
Combining aeration and seeding is one of the most effective ways to enhance your lawn's health and appearance.
Here are the key benefits of performing these two services together:
​
1. Improved Seed Germination and Growth: Aeration creates holes in compacted soil, allowing grass seed to penetrate deeper and establish stronger roots. This leads to better seed-to-soil contact, faster germination, and healthier, thicker grass.
​
2. Enhanced Nutrient and Water Absorption: Aeration loosens the soil, improving the flow of water, nutrients, and air to the root system. When combined with seeding, new grass benefits from optimal growing conditions, ensuring robust growth.
​
3. Fills Bare Spots and Reduces Weeds: Seeding after aeration helps fill in bare or thinning areas of the lawn. A thicker, healthier lawn naturally crowds out weeds, leaving less room for them to grow.
​
4. Boosts Lawn Resilience and Appearance: Aeration and seeding together promote a dense, vibrant lawn that's more resistant to drought, diseases, and pests, while also enhancing the overall look and curb appeal of your property.
